Gun Control Measure Seeing Bipartisan Support In Senate
One gun control measure is winning bipartisan support in the Senate.
FOX News Radio’s Jared Halpern reports from Washington:
Audio clip:
The legislation would create federal penalties for so-called straw purchases, buying a firearm for the sole purpose of selling it to someone else.
(Collins) “These guns are frequently sold, resold and trafficked across state lines.”
Maine Republican Susan Collins unveiling the revamped gun trafficking bill along with its author Vermont Democratic Senator Patrick Leahy.
(Leahy) “No question we can do this in a way that’s consistent with the rights guaranteed by the Second Amendment.”
It’s part of a larger gun control package the Senate Judiciary Committee plans to consider later this week.
